Responsibilities:

  • Process Safety data according to applicable regulations, guidelines, Standard Operating procedures (SOPs) and project requirements.
  • To perform Pharmacovigilance activities per project requirement including but not limited to, collecting and tracking incoming Adverse Events(AE)/endpoint information determining initial/update status of incoming events, database entry, coding AE and Products, writing narratives, Literature related activities, Quality review, assisting with reconciliation, case closure related activities, coordinating translations, as per internal/ project timelines. Creating, maintaining and tracking cases as applicable to the project plan.
  • Perform activities related to adjudication as applicable.
  • Assess Safety data for reportability to relevant authorities, track reportable cases and report to regulatory authorities, ethics committees, institutional review boards, investigators, oversight groups per legislation, within timelines and in a format compatible to meet requirement as per project.
  • Liaise with relevant stakeholders to facilitate expedited reporting.
  • Liaise with manager for regulatory tracking requirements and electronic reporting.
